Tunable laser source

The FLS-2600 contains both a tunable laser and a broadband source and is insensitive to vibration, making it suitable for use in production testing of WDM components. The device has a sidemode suppression ratio of 65 dB, providing a dynamic range for testing passive DWDM components and allowing the user to measure crosstalk at a

level that would not be possible using a traditional external cavity laser, according to the manufacturer. The tunable laser can be switched for use as a high-power ASE source.

EXFO Electro-Optical Engineering Inc.

Vanier, QC, Canada
